#53292a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53292a is composed of 32.5% red, 16.1%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 358.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 24.3%. #53292a color hex could be obtained by blending #a65254 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#53292a color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#53292a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#53292a has RGB values of R:83, G:41,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.49,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5450026.

Shades and Tints of #53292a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53292a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403c3c is the less saturated color, while #790306 is the most saturated one.
